首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>错误:未能启动修补程序cert循环mutatingwebhookconfigurations.admissionregistration.k8s.io“喷射器”未找到

错误:未能启动修补程序cert循环mutatingwebhookconfigurations.admissionregistration.k8s.io“喷射器”未找到
EN

Stack Overflow用户
提问于 2019-09-26 19:37:40
回答 1查看 548关注 0票数 0

从舵图中获取安装istio时的"istio-sidecar-injector" not found错误。

代码语言:javascript
运行
复制
NAME                                      READY     STATUS             RESTARTS   AGE
certmanager-b8dc8f99c-bw52l               1/1       Running            0          2m
istio-citadel-5cf47dbf7c-2brk9            1/1       Running            0          2m
istio-galley-7898b587db-n44z9             1/1       Running            0          2m
istio-ingressgateway-5d88688454-wrxsr     2/2       Running            0          2m
istio-init-crd-10-5rkt6                   0/1       Completed          0          2m
istio-init-crd-11-pg447                   0/1       Completed          0          2m
istio-init-crd-12-mxrhz                   0/1       Completed          0          2m
istio-pilot-57b48b77bf-nbjtv              2/2       Running            0          2m
istio-policy-769664fcf7-59v2n             2/2       Running            0          2m
istio-sidecar-injector-677bd5ccc5-ckql5   0/1       CrashLoopBackOff   4          2m
istio-telemetry-f5798dbb7-z6dvz           2/2       Running            1          2m
prometheus-776fdf7479-psrf5               1/1       Running            0          2m

描述Pod

代码语言:javascript
运行
复制
Name:               istio-sidecar-injector-677bd5ccc5-v4shl
Namespace:          istio-system
Priority:           0
PriorityClassName:  <none>
Node:               aks-agentpool-17141372-2/10.240.0.66
Start Time:         Thu, 26 Sep 2019 14:53:55 -0400
Labels:             app=sidecarInjectorWebhook
            chart=sidecarInjectorWebhook
            heritage=Tiller
            istio=sidecar-injector
            pod-template-hash=677bd5ccc5
            release=istio
Annotations:        sidecar.istio.io/inject=false
Status:             Running
IP:                 10.240.0.93
Controlled By:      ReplicaSet/istio-sidecar-injector-677bd5ccc5
Containers:
  sidecar-injector-webhook:
    Container ID:  docker://e5c96af389797e7a0488cf0dac180ff3494fe8602c2cd7a50080e8a848be207a
    Image:         docker.io/istio/sidecar_injector:1.2.5
    Image ID:      docker-pullable://istio/sidecar_injector@sha256:6c281139337df6e2f96f3d883e5dc2a75cb6234986ae4f1cd3f9f324112b46eb
    Port:          <none>
    Host Port:     <none>
    Args:
      --caCertFile=/etc/istio/certs/root-cert.pem
      --tlsCertFile=/etc/istio/certs/cert-chain.pem
      --tlsKeyFile=/etc/istio/certs/key.pem
      --injectConfig=/etc/istio/inject/config
      --meshConfig=/etc/istio/config/mesh
      --healthCheckInterval=2s
      --healthCheckFile=/health
    State:          Waiting
      Reason:       CrashLoopBackOff
    Last State:     Terminated
      Reason:       Error
      Exit Code:    255
      Started:      Thu, 26 Sep 2019 14:55:32 -0400
      Finished:     Thu, 26 Sep 2019 14:55:32 -0400
    Ready:          False
    Restart Count:  4
    Requests:
      cpu:        10m
    Liveness:     exec [/usr/local/bin/sidecar-injector probe --probe-path=/health --interval=4s] delay=4s timeout=1s period=4s #success=1 #failure=3
    Readiness:    exec [/usr/local/bin/sidecar-injector probe --probe-path=/health --interval=4s] delay=4s timeout=1s period=4s #success=1 #failure=3
    Environment:  <none>
    Mounts:
      /etc/istio/certs from certs (ro)
      /etc/istio/config from config-volume (ro)
      /etc/istio/inject from inject-config (ro)
      /var/run/secrets/kubernetes.io/serviceaccount from istio-sidecar-injector-service-account-token-nxc4z (ro)
Conditions:
  Type              Status
  Initialized       True
  Ready             False
  ContainersReady   False
  PodScheduled      True
Volumes:
  config-volume:
    Type:      ConfigMap (a volume populated by a ConfigMap)
    Name:      istio
    Optional:  false
  certs:
    Type:        Secret (a volume populated by a Secret)
    SecretName:  istio.istio-sidecar-injector-service-account
    Optional:    false
  inject-config:
    Type:      ConfigMap (a volume populated by a ConfigMap)
    Name:      istio-sidecar-injector
    Optional:  false
  istio-sidecar-injector-service-account-token-nxc4z:
    Type:        Secret (a volume populated by a Secret)
    SecretName:  istio-sidecar-injector-service-account-token-nxc4z
    Optional:    false
QoS Class:       Burstable
Node-Selectors:  <none>
Tolerations:     node.kubernetes.io/not-ready:NoExecute for 300s
         node.kubernetes.io/unreachable:NoExecute for 300s
Events:
  Type     Reason     Age               From                               Message
  ----     ------     ----              ----                               -------
  Normal   Scheduled  2m                default-scheduler                  Successfully assigned istio-system/istio-sidecar-injector-677bd5ccc5-v4shl to aks-agentpool-17141372-2
  Warning  BackOff    1m (x10 over 2m)  kubelet, aks-agentpool-17141372-2  Back-off restarting failed container
  Normal   Pulled     1m (x5 over 2m)   kubelet, aks-agentpool-17141372-2  Container image "docker.io/istio/sidecar_injector:1.2.5" already present on machine
  Normal   Created    1m (x5 over 2m)   kubelet, aks-agentpool-17141372-2  Created container sidecar-injector-webhook
  Normal   Started    1m (x5 over 2m)   kubelet, aks-agentpool-17141372-2  Started container sidecar-injector-webhook

istio版本:v1.2.5

Istio是如何安装的?:头盔图

日志

错误:未能启动修补程序cert循环mutatingwebhookconfigurations.admissionregistration.k8s.io“喷射器”未找到

我不知道是什么导致了上面的错误。

EN

回答 1

Stack Overflow用户

发布于 2019-09-27 21:23:05

CrashLoopBackOff状态意味着吊舱在循环中开始并崩溃。

所以,试着调查istio-sidecar-injector-677bd5ccc5-ckql5荚的日志。

第6553期

另外,请尝试以下问题#6553:istio注射器启动失败- CrashLoopBackOff中的提示:

关于sidecar-injector

自动Istio侧面注射用库伯内特斯钩子。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/58123650

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档